During the mid 1980s the price of gasoline fell. Americans purchased not only more gasoline but other goods as well. Use consumer theory to explain why this happened.
 
  What will be an ideal response?

Answer to Question 2

Essentially two effects are unleashed at the same time. The substitution effect induces people to consume more of the good whose relative price fell and the income effect from the lower-priced gasoline induces people to consumer more of all goods including gasoline.
